


Detailed explanation of usage examples of private attributes in PHP classes
首先 这个题目就有点问题 因为private属性是不能被继承的
请仔细看这句话 如果父类有私有的属性。那么父类的方法只为父类的私有属性服务。
下面通过一系列列子来加深理解.
这个例子看起来很奇怪,在子类中重新定义了一个属性$sal,系统却返回了父类的属性。
<?php class employee{ private $sal=3000; //protected $sal=3000; public function getSal(){ return $this->sal; } } class Manager extends employee { protected $sal=5000; public function getParentSal(){ //这里返回的是父类的private属性. return parent::getSal(); } } $manager = new Manager(); echo "PHP ".phpversion()."<br>"; echo $manager->getSal(); echo "<br>"; echo "parent's \$sal ".$manager->getParentSal(); ?>
程序运行结果:
PHP 5.3.8 3000 parent's $sal 3000
如果父类中的属性被子类重写了。结果是这样的。注意 第5行的属性定义变成了protected。
<?php class employee{ //private $sal=3000; protected $sal=3000; public function getSal(){ return $this->sal; } } class Manager extends employee { protected $sal=5000; public function getParentSal(){ //这里返回的是父类的private属性. return parent::getSal(); } } $manager = new Manager(); echo "PHP ".phpversion()."<br>"; echo $manager->getSal(); echo "<br>"; echo "parent's \$sal ".$manager->getParentSal(); ?>
程序运行结果:
PHP 5.3.8 5000 parent's $sal 5000
第一个列子中 父类的private $sal没有被重写 所以$manager->getSal()这个父类的方法 调用的是父类自己的私有属性$sal 此时内存中有两个$sal
第二个列子中 父类的protected $sal被重写 $manager->getSal()这个父类的方法 调用已经被重写的$sal 父类的$sal在内存中是不存在的 此时内存中只有一个$sal
接下来看第三个列子
子类中重写的方法对当前private有效。
<?php class employee{ private $sal=3000; public function getSal(){ return $this->sal; } } class Manager extends employee { private $sal=5000; //重写过的方法 public function getSal(){ return $this->sal; } public function getParentSal(){ //这里返回的是父类的private属性. return parent::getSal(); } } $manager = new Manager(); echo "PHP ".phpversion()."<br>"; echo $manager->getSal(); echo "<br>"; echo "parent's \$sal ".$manager->getParentSal(); ?>
运行结果
PHP 5.3.8 5000 parent's $sal 3000
这个列子中子类重写getSal()方法 所以他调用的是子类的属性
如果你注释子类的这一行
//private $sal=5000;
你会发现一个错误:Notice: Undefined property: Manager::$sal in E:\wamp\www\oo\2-5\2-5-3.php on line 14
如果注释掉12行的子类重写方法 那么echo $manager->getSal();得到的结果是 父类的私有属性$sal 3000
打开zend调试状态看看,内存中的情况。注意最下面,有两个$sal 。分别是 3000 和 5000 。
<?php class employee{ private $sal=3000; public function getSal(){ return $this->sal; } } class Manager extends employee { protected $sal=5000; public function getParentSal(){ return $this->sal; } } $manager = new Manager(); echo "PHP ".phpversion()."<br>"; echo $manager->getSal(); ?>
程序运行结果:
PHP 5.3.8 3000
将父类的属性$sal 改成 protected ,子类重写了父类的属性。在内存中只有一个 $sal 。
<?php class employee{ protected $sal=3000; public function getSal(){ return $this->sal; } } class Manager extends employee { protected $sal=5000; public function getParentSal(){ return $this->sal; } } $manager = new Manager(); echo "PHP ".phpversion()."<br>"; echo $manager->getSal(); ?>
程序运行结果:
PHP 5.3.8 5000
如果你学过java,你会觉得这一切都是很难理解的。
在Java中当子类被创建时,父类的属性和方法在内存中都被创建,甚至构造函数也要被调用。
PHP5不是这样,PHP5调用父类用的是parent:: 而不是 parent-> ,这足以说明PHP5不想在内存中让父类也被创建。PHP5想让继承变的比Java更简单。适应下就好。
